Abstract
The rise of digital health technologies has provided individuals with unprecedented access to biometric data and health insights. However, excess monitoring may contribute to fatigue, anxiety, and information overload, sometimes reducing engagement and worsening outcomes. This article explores how artificial intelligence-enabled assistants might help address this challenge by filtering, contextualizing, and personalizing health information, potentially supporting informed self-management while mitigating some unintended harms of digital health technologies.
